3 Things to Consider When Choosing a Drug Rehab in Sheyenne, ND

Is The Treatment Center Accredited?

A good way to determine if a drug rehab in Sheyenne is ideal would be by checking if it is accredited. In particular, you should find out if the program has JCBH - Joint Commission Behavioral Health Accreditation.

Other accreditations that you need to check - and which would point out that the program offers excellent treatment staff and facilities - include but are not limited to:

  • Commission on Accreditation and Rehabilitation Facilities
  • Council on Accreditation
  • Healthcare Facilities Accreditation Program
  • National Committee for Quality Assurance
  • The Joint Commission
  • What Kind of Setting Is the Rehab In?

    There are many things that you should think about while looking for a drug rehab program in Sheyenne. For instance, you need to find out as much as you can about the setting in which the rehab is located.

    If it is close to a high-risk neighborhood, your probability of relapsing would be higher - especially if you choose outpatient treatment. The important thing is to ensure that you choose a rehab center that is located in a setting that can motivate you to continue with your recovery journey over the long term.

    Do They Offer Relapse Prevention Techniques?

    Relapse prevention is one of the most essential components of recovery. This is because addiction is a relapsing condition, and you may always have a high risk of falling back to your old drug using habits even after having been through a treatment program.

    For this reason, you may want to check into a drug rehab program in Sheyenne that offers a wide variety of relapse prevention techniques. These may come in the form of 12 step support group meetings, non-12 step meetings, individual therapy, group counseling, family counseling, and sober living programs, among others.
